Course Details
• Fundamentals of Coating Mechanical Properties: An introduction to the key concepts of coating mechanical properties, including hardness, adhesion, and flexibility. • Mechanical Testing Methods: An overview of testing methods used to evaluate coating mechanical properties, such as scratch testing, indentation testing, and pull-off testing. • Coating Hardness: A deep dive into the concept of coating hardness, including its measurement and significance in coating performance. • Coating Adhesion: A study of coating adhesion, including the factors affecting adhesion and testing methods used to measure it. • Coating Flexibility: An examination of coating flexibility and its impact on coating performance in various applications. • Mechanical Properties of Paints and Coatings: A review of the mechanical properties of paints and coatings, including their relationship to coating performance and durability. • Advanced Techniques in Coating Mechanical Properties: An exploration of cutting-edge techniques used to enhance the mechanical properties of coatings, including nano-engineering and advanced coating formulations.
• Case Studies in Coating Mechanical Properties: A collection of real-world case studies that demonstrate the impact of coating mechanical properties on coating performance and durability. • Emerging Trends in Coating Mechanical Properties: A look at the latest trends and developments in the field of coating mechanical properties, including new testing methods and emerging technologies.
